Italy and the Black Death on TV - TV SPIELFILM

Summary by tvspielfilm.de
In the 14th century Siena is a thriving, hopeful trading and pilgrimage city, until the plague strikes in 1348. According to estimates, the Black Death ravages up to two thirds of the population and leaves behind a traumatized...
